Breaking Down the Essential Mechanics of JetX
JetX is a pure test of timing and nerve. Each round begins with your bet. You’re anticipating how high the multiplier will rise before the jet, shown as a rising line on a graph, vanishes. Starting at 1.00, the multiplier creeps upward. Your task is to cash out before the jet crashes at a unpredictable moment. Cash out in time, and your win is your bet times that cash-out value. If the jet ends first, you lose the bet. This setup creates a clear psychological tug-of-war. Waiting longer means a bigger potential win, but it also risks losing everything. It all boils down to managing risk. The game’s charm is in this single crucial choice. A verified random number generator determines each crash point, making every round independent and unforeseeable. This is a core requirement for any trustworthy game available to UK players.

Strategic Depth and Wagering Strategies
JetX seems basic on its face, but it permits real strategic thinking. No strategy can guarantee a win because the crash point is random. The basis of smart play is managing your bankroll. From my own testing, I’ve seen a few popular approaches. An aggressive strategy lets bets ride to high multipliers, aiming for large but rare wins. This is high-risk. A conservative method cashes out reliably at lower multipliers like 1.50x or 2.00x, securing frequent, smaller profits. A balanced tactic might split your bankroll, trying various approaches with each portion. A key tool here is the auto-cashout feature. Setting a target multiplier in advance promotes discipline, taking emotion and impulse out of the equation. For the UK player, the right mindset is to see JetX as a game of probability, not a solvable puzzle. Accepting that each round is a standalone event is the first step toward enjoyable, sustainable play.
JetX in the Context of the UK Gambling Market
The UK gambling market works under some of the world’s strictest regulations. The Gambling Commission imposes tough rules on fairness, player protection, and preventing financial crime. For a game like JetX to prosper here, it must fit within this strict framework. I’ve verified that legitimate versions of JetX are available at licensed UK casinos. This means the game’s random number generator is tested for fairness, and its return-to-player (RTP) percentage is published—usually around 97% or more, a figure that matches the best slots. This transparency is mandatory. Beyond that, UK-licensed sites must integrate responsible gambling tools directly into the game environment. These include deposit limits, time-outs, and self-exclusion. When you play JetX on a UKGC-licensed site, you’re not just playing a game; you’re in a protected ecosystem. This regulatory context converts the game’s thrilling volatility into a managed experience, not a reckless one.
